Crash on the B686 - 6 Mar 1985
Accident reference 1985317Y20195
Accident summary
On Wednesday 6 March 1985 at 08:45 a slight collision occurred near B686, B685 involving 2 vehicles and 1 casualty (1 slight) Weather at the time was recorded as fine no high winds. Road surface conditions were dry. Lighting was described as daylight.
